a title given when achieving the speed of 90 mph in a green van
hey bra matt is a total Speed mc Speed going 90mph in his green van
by Gnarly May 15, 2007
dank bitch 1: hey girl did you see that Matt kid in his mini van he was goin like 90 mph

dank bitch 2: hell ya hes such a hottie, defineately speed mc speed worthy.
by Matt21212121212121 May 22, 2007
